Turkish officials have renewed calls for Saudi Arabia to cooperate in the murder investigation of Washington Post Columnist Jamal Khashoggi, after a prosecutor revealed yesterday that Khashoggi was strangled as soon as he entered the consulate. Saudi officials have no commented on the claim, as of now.Nov. 1, 2018
